The Evolution of Online Sports Betting
Sports betting has actually existed for centuries, however its transition to the online sphere was a game-changer. The intro of digital betting platforms in the late 1990s and early 2000s developed a more vibrant and accessible way for sports enthusiasts to place wagers. With advancements in innovation, mobile applications, and real-time information analytics, betting platforms have actually ended up being more sophisticated, offering users live betting, gamer props, and even esports wagering.
Online sportsbooks supply many benefits over conventional bookmakers. The ease of use, ability to put bets from anywhere, and access to real-time stats and chances make online platforms the preferred option for many bettors. Furthermore, the variety of betting choices has expanded beyond simple moneyline bets to consist of spreads, totals, parlays, teasers, and in-game betting, creating an immersive experience for users.

Legal and Regulatory Challenges
Regardless of the fast growth of online sports betting, the industry stays subject to various legal and regulatory obstacles. The legality of online sports betting varies by nation and, in the United States, by state. The repeal of the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PASPA) in 2018 allowed specific states to legalize sports betting, leading to a rise in online sportsbooks going into the marketplace.
However, offshore sportsbooks like BetOnline operate in a legal gray area in the U.S. While the platform is certified worldwide, it is not regulated by any U.S. video gaming commission. This implies that although Americans can utilize BetOnline, they do so at their own discretion, as the platform does not provide the same customer protections as locally certified sportsbooks.
Many states have actually decided to launch their own regulated sports betting markets, with major gamers like DraftKings, FanDuel, and BetMGM securing licenses. While this has provided gamblers with more choices, offshore sportsbooks continue to draw in users due to better odds, higher betting limitations, and fewer constraints.
The Impact of Online Betting on Sports
The increase of online sports betting has had a profound impact on professional and collegiate sports. Sponsorship offers in between betting companies and sports leagues have actually become common, with sportsbooks partnering with groups and organizations to promote their brands. This has actually led to increased profits streams for leagues and teams however has also raised issues about the capacity for match-fixing and gaming addiction.
Furthermore, the combination of betting information into broadcasts has altered the way fans view games. Many networks now show live chances and betting insights throughout games, accommodating the growing variety of sports bettors.
